United Arab Emirates - Re-Export of Reciprocating Positive Displacement Pumps

Since 2014, United Arab Emirates Re-Export of Reciprocating Positive Displacement Pumps rose 18.2% year on year. With $59,747,585.49 in 2019, the country was number 2 among other countries in Re-Export of Reciprocating Positive Displacement Pumps. United States lead the ranking with $209,896,463.93 in 2019, a growth of 5.7% compared to 2018. Thailand recorded the best 5 years average growth at +112% per year, while Jamaica was the worst growing country at -37.2% per year.
